Florianopolis Santa Catarina, Brazil Travel Guide

Air Travel

Airport & Airlines

Hercílio Luz International Airport (FLN), commonly known as Florianópolis Airport, serves as the main gateway to the island.

Airlines & Routes

  • LATAM, GOL, and Azul: Main Brazilian airlines.
  • Numerous daily flights to major Brazilian cities (São Paulo, Rio, Brasília).
  • Limited direct international flights; connect via São Paulo (GRU) or Rio (GIG).

Flight Connections

All travelers from North America, Europe, Asia, or Africa require at least one connection, usually through São Paulo (GRU) or Rio de Janeiro (GIG) in Brazil.

Connect Through These Hubs

  • São Paulo (GRU) or Rio de Janeiro (GIG) are main connection points.
  • Occasional connections via other prominent From South america hubs.
  • Seasonal direct flights from nearby From South america cities (Ba, Santiago, Montevideo).

Seasonal Flights

International flights from nearby South American countries see significant increases during high season (December-February).

Airport Amenities

The modern terminal (opened 2019) features shops, restaurants, vehicle rental firms, ATMs, currency exchange, plus duty-free options.

Airport Transfers

Taxis, ride-sharing apps (Uber/99), and public buses connect the airport to various parts of the city and main bus terminal.

Land Transportation

Long-Distance Buses

Florianópolis features a well-connected intercity bus terminal (Rodoviária de Florianópolis) in the city center.

Bus Companies & Routes

  • Major companies: Auto Viação Catarinense, Eucatur, Itapemirim, Penha.
  • Frequent services connect to major Brazilian cities (São Paulo, Rio, Curitiba).
  • Comfort: Options from conventional to executive, semi-bed, and full-bed.

Self-Driving

Driving offers flexibility for exploring. Carry your valid driver's license from home.

Driving Rules

  • International Driving Permit (IDP) is highly recommended.
  • Drive on the right side of the road.
  • Everyone must wear a seatbelt.

Road Conditions

Major highways, like BR-101, are generally in good condition. Roads on the island range in quality.

Traffic & Tolls

  • Expect heavy traffic during high season, especially on bridges.
  • Be prepared for toll roads (pedágios) on major highways.
  • Drive defensively and continue to be aware of various drivers.

Parking & Safety

Finding parking can present a challenge and be expensive in popular shorelines and the city center.

Parking Tips

  • Look for pay parking areas ("estacionamento").
  • Utilize street parking, often paid via "Zona Azul" system.
  • Avoid parking in off-limits areas to prevent towing.

Sea & River Arrivals

Cruise & Ferry

Florianópolis features a relatively new cruise terminal positioned at the old downtown port area (Terminal de Passageiros do Porto de Florianópolis).

Water Routes

  • The terminal welcomes cruise ships, especially November-April.
  • Passengers disembark without stopping into the city center.
  • A local vessel services are available for tours to Ilha do Campeche or Fortaleza of Saint (feminine) Cruz.

Terminal Connectivity

The cruise terminal's location in the city center supplies convenient access to local transportation.

Easy Access to Land Transport

  • Main bus terminal is close by.
  • Taxis are readily available.
  • Ride-sharing services operate from the area.

Immigration

Federal authorities handle international cruise immigration either onboard the ship or upon disembarkation.
